Prepared Caregivers Toolkit

Today, RCI and the Returning Service Members – U.S. Dept. of Veterans Affairs are releasing Prepared Caregivers: A Toolkit for Caregivers of Veterans for Disaster Preparedness, a guide to help caregivers of Veterans prepare for disasters, including environmental catastrophes and pandemics.
